MMMMMagic (magic expansion patch)
Version: 2.0
Release Date: 9/17/2016
Author: B-Run
Applies to: FF3us 1.0 ROM
ROM should be expanded prior to patching using FF3usME, Lunar Expand, or manually.
Download (Advanced)
Download (Plug and Play)


Three months and 200+ hours in development; the MMMMMagic update is here!

This patch updates the magic system in FF3us to be more RAM efficient, enabling hackers to have up to 16 unique, reusable magic lists and an extra 10 new spells within those lists. New spells can be set into espers and natural magic just like any other spell. In addition to this expansion, there is increased flexibility in editing for hackers:
  • edit what spells appear in the magic menu,
  • edit spell menu order,
  • edit who gets which magic list, 
  • edit who gets cumulative (Gogo-style) magic,
  • edit what is considered black/gray/white magic,
  • allows magic to be learned via event command 66,
  • frees up 85 ($55) bytes of SRAM
    
This expansion is primarily accomplished by tracking spell progression by esper instead of by spell. Once a spell is ready to be learned, it enables a bit for that spell for that character. Due to this change, the ability to learn magic from equipment is disabled. However, this is partially offset by the addition of event command 66 which allows spells to be learned in event code. Event command 66 is a 3 byte command that follows the format "66 AA BB", where AA=list ID, and BB=spell ID.

There are two versions of the patch: the Advanced and the Plug-and-Play versions.



MMMMMagic 2.0 Advanced

The "Advanced" version of the hack does not set up any new spells for you. This is designed for hackers who are more comfortable editing data and want to choose how/where to implement new spells. Check the "readme" for instructions on how to add up to 10 new spells to the spell list.

[b]What's included with in "MMMMMagic.zip":
  • MMMMMagic.ips (Lunar IPS patch for headered ROM)
  • MMMMMagic.asm (xkas patch)
  • MMMMMagic.txt (full disassembly for the patch)
  • SpellDesc.bin (spell description data, imported by the .asm)
  • SpellDescPntr.bin (spell description pointers, imported by the .asm)
  • readme.txt (important "how to" information)
        


MMMMMagic 2.0 Plug-and-Play

The "Plug-and-Play" version of the hack adds 10 new spells, overwriting desperation attacks, and places them on appropriate espers. This is for hackers who are less comfortable editing certain kinds of data within hex. You can still edit these new spells and using the instructions included you can edit just as much as the "advanced" version of the patch.

What's included with in "MMMMMagic Plug-and-Play.zip":
  • MMMMMagic-PNP-header.ips (Lunar IPS patch for headered ROM)
  • MMMMMagic-PNP.ips (Lunar IPS patch for unheadered ROM)
  • MMMMMagic.txt (full disassembly for the patch)
  • readme.txt (important "how to" information)
New Spells and updated Espers in the plug-and-play version:
Code:
Drain2
 Drains HP from all enemies
    MP Cost:   53
    Power:     66
    On Esper:  Fenrir (x2)
Virus
 Poison-elemental attack
    MP Cost:   66
    Power:     114
    Status:    Poison
    On Esper:  ZoneSeek (x3)
Octant
 Cuts all enemies HP by 7/8
    MP Cost:   67
    On Esper:  Terrato (x2)
Flood
 Unfocused Water-elemental attack
    MP Cost:   60
    Power:     100
    On Esper:  Ragnarok (x2)
Blind
 Blinds target
    MP Cost:   7
    Status:    Blind
    On Esper:  Stray (x2), Phantom (x5)
Blink
 Avoids 1 physical attack
    MP Cost:   19
    Status:    Image
    On Esper:  Raiden (x3)
Morph
 Turns enemy into an item
    MP Cost:   38
    On Esper:  Ragnarok (x2)
Wall
 Casts Shell/Safe on target
    MP Cost:   45
    Status:    Safe/Shell
    On Esper:  Golem (x1)
Renew
 Recovers HP and gives Regen
    MP Cost:   28
    Power:     24
    Status:    Regen
    On Esper:  Alexandr (x2)
Heal
 Recovers HP and cures status ailments
    MP Cost:   38
    Power:     32
    LiftStatus:Dark,Poison,Petrify,Mute,Muddle,Seizure,Sleep,Slow,Stop
    On Esper:  Starlet (x1)

updated a small bug where if you wanted to assign one of the natural magic lists to an extended character (like, higher than Gogo), it wouldn't apply properly.

Also in the original I had labeled one of the C0 functions as replacing code that was actually in previously free code. Updated it so that people who have edits in C0 have less potential for accidental conflict.

Neither of these should cause problems for 99% of users.

(12-24-2017, 03:50 PM)Blunderpuggs Wrote: Sorry for the necropost, but how would I switch Gau's and Gogo's magic list? The patch seems like a nice perk to any hack, but I'm not interested in having all tjose different magic lists.

Sorry for the Necro-reply, you just need to change these values

F3/000B: FF
F3/000C: 0B

That's literally it. Gogo will learn magic like a normal character, Gau will get his magic based off of the rest of the party.
